Don, I've got a good friend who's a BMW/Porsche dealer parts manager. He's always said good things about the X5, little problems noted. However, he just got back from a big national
Cayenne intro for parts and service people and is raving about it. So, maybe wait a few weeks and drive the X5 and the Cayenne and make a decision. I do know that Porsche used the X5 as a benchmark in their development. At first they purchased a Jeep Cheroke and installed their engine and drive-train in it before they had a body to test. They soon dumped the Jeep and concentrated on the X-5 for their development. Either way, you won't make a mistake.
